Code P0C34 2015 Chevrolet Silverado Description

The P0C34 diagnostic trouble code (DTC) indicates a performance issue with the Hybrid/EV Battery Temperature Sensor 6 in a 2015 Chevrolet Silverado. This sensor is crucial for monitoring the temperature of the hybrid battery pack, which is essential for optimal performance and longevity. The hybrid battery operates within a specific temperature range; if it becomes too hot or too cold, it can lead to reduced efficiency, diminished power output, and potential damage to the battery cells.

Common Causes of P0C34 2015 Chevrolet Silverado

  1. Faulty hybrid battery temperature sensor 6, which may provide inaccurate readings.
  2. Damaged wiring or connectors leading to the sensor, resulting in poor communication with the ECM.
  3. Environmental factors, such as extreme heat or cold, affecting sensor performance.
  4. Software issues within the vehicle's ECM that may misinterpret sensor data.
  5. Accumulation of debris or corrosion at the sensor connection points, leading to poor electrical contact.

Symptoms of P0C34 2015 Chevrolet Silverado

  1. Reduced acceleration or sluggish performance when driving.
  2. Warning lights illuminated on the dashboard, such as the check engine light.
  3. The vehicle may enter limp mode, limiting power and speed.
  4. Inconsistent or erratic battery charge levels displayed on the dashboard.
  5. Overheating of the hybrid battery, which may be noticeable through increased cabin heat or unusual noises from the battery compartment.

How to Fix P0C34 2015 Chevrolet Silverado

  1. Diagnostic Scan: Begin with a thorough diagnostic scan to confirm the P0C34 code and check for any related codes that may provide additional context.
  2. Visual Inspection: Conduct a visual inspection of the wiring and connectors associated with the temperature sensor to identify any signs of damage, corrosion, or loose connections.
  3. Sensor Replacement: If the sensor is found to be faulty, replace it with a new, OEM-quality part to ensure compatibility and reliability.
  4. Wiring Repair: If damaged wiring or connectors are identified, repair or replace them as necessary to restore proper communication between the sensor and the ECM.
  5. ECM Reprogramming: After repairs, it may be necessary to reprogram or reset the ECM to clear the code and ensure it correctly interprets the new sensor data.

Cost to Fix P0C34 2015 Chevrolet Silverado

The typical repair costs for addressing a P0C34 code can vary widely based on the specific issue identified during diagnostics. On average, the cost for parts (such as a new temperature sensor) can range from $50 to $200. Labor costs can vary significantly, typically ranging from $80 to $150 per hour, depending on the shop's location and expertise. Overall, the total repair cost may fall between $150 and $600, including parts and labor. It's important to note that labor rates can be higher at dealerships or in metropolitan areas, while independent shops may offer more competitive pricing. For a more precise estimate, it's advisable to check local rates and obtain quotes from several repair shops.

Frequently Asked Questions about P0C34 2015 Chevrolet Silverado Code

What does the OBDII code P0C34 mean on a 2015 Chevrolet Silverado?

P0C34 indicates an issue with the performance of Hybrid/EV Battery Temperature Sensor 6, which monitors the temperature of a specific section of the hybrid/EV battery pack.

What are the symptoms of a P0C34 code on a 2015 Chevrolet Silverado?

Symptoms may include the hybrid/EV system warning light turning on, reduced fuel efficiency, limited hybrid system performance, or the vehicle entering a fail-safe mode.

What causes the P0C34 code to appear?

Common causes include a faulty battery temperature sensor, damaged wiring or connectors, corrosion in the sensor circuit, or issues with the hybrid battery control module.

Can I drive my 2015 Chevrolet Silverado with a P0C34 code?

While the vehicle may still be drivable, it’s not recommended as the hybrid battery system could overheat or operate inefficiently, potentially causing further damage.

How do you diagnose a P0C34 code?

Diagnosis involves scanning for additional codes, visually inspecting the sensor wiring and connectors, testing the sensor’s electrical resistance, and checking the hybrid battery control module for faults.

How is the P0C34 code repaired?

Repairs may include replacing the faulty battery temperature sensor, repairing or replacing damaged wiring or connectors, cleaning corroded components, or reprogramming/updating the hybrid battery control module.

What tools are needed to diagnose and fix a P0C34 code?

You’ll need an OBDII scanner capable of reading hybrid system codes, a multimeter for electrical testing, and basic automotive tools for accessing and replacing components.

How much does it cost to fix a P0C34 code?

Repair costs can vary but generally range from $150 to $500, depending on whether the repair involves replacing just the sensor or addressing wiring and module issues.

Can a P0C34 code be caused by low battery voltage?

Yes, low voltage or a weak hybrid battery can cause inaccurate readings from the temperature sensor, potentially triggering the P0C34 code.

Is it possible to reset the P0C34 code without repairing the issue?

While you can clear the code using an OBDII scanner, it will likely return if the underlying problem isn’t resolved.
